Output abdbdfd2a6e7afc8a1e06e8744cb238fd583338ba122bb2d883eb87a239c9099:2

value
5303564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2003618563b80820ad58438603146f23f2997b5e OP_EQUAL
address
34cHbbRNdECTbGrfrB6Jrz4byNZ1ERQdSb
transaction
abdbdfd2a6e7afc8a1e06e8744cb238fd583338ba122bb2d883eb87a239c9099
confirmations
159659
spent
true